How do I cancel my MetroPCS account?

Metro PCS requires a phone call to customer service at 1-888-863-8768 to request cancellation. In all likelihood, you’re going to be asked to bring documentation and the device into a T-Mobile store.

Can you cancel MetroPCS anytime?

As a subscriber with MetroPCS, you’re not under any contract to cancel your service, so you’re free to cancel anytime.

Can I cancel a MetroPCS payment?

You may cancel an Autopay Payment at any time up to three (3) Business Days prior to the date such payment is scheduled to be made. To cancel an Autopay Payment, log into your MetroPCS eWallet account on www.metroPCS.com and follow the instructions to remove the AutoPay preference from the Funding Account.

What happens if I don’t pay my MetroPCS bill?

If you forget to make a payment by your due date, your service will be temporarily suspended until a payment is made. Late payments may result in fewer days of service that month. If you don’t make a payment for two consecutive due dates, your service will be disconnected and your phone number may be given away.

What happens when you suspend your phone?

Suspending service means your phone will no longer connect to your carrier’s network, and you cannot make any calls or send texts. It’s not a permanent solution as most carriers limit the length of suspension to a few months, after which service resumes automatically and you’re back to being charged your full rate.

Can I pay half of my MetroPCS bill?

Metro PCS does not set a required minimum amount, so you can always pay what you can afford at the moment. You can pay off your Metro PCS bill in installments. For instance, some people split the bill and pay one half of the total amount at the beginning of the billing cycle and the other half closer to the due date.
